Poor Emergence of <i>Brassica</i> Species in Saline–Sodic Soil Is Improved by Biochar Addition

Salt-affected soil areas are increasing in the Northern Great Plains (NGP), with patches occurring in some of the most productive croplands. High electrical conductivity (EC) and sodium and/or sulfate concentrations of saline–sodic areas impede the growth and yield of ‘normal’ [corn (<i>Zea ma...
